Sadbhav Engineering has allotted 71,325 unlisted, secured NCDs worth about Rs. 713.25 crore to its existing lenders in furtherance of a debt restructuring plan. The first tranche of 36,376 NCDs totals Rs. 363.76 crore at a 9% per annum coupon, maturing on 31 March 2031, with principal repayments spread from March 2026 to March 2031. The second tranche of 34,949 NCDs totals Rs. 349.49 crore at a very low 0.01% per annum coupon, maturing on 31 March 2034, with repayments spread over 8 years. Notably, 8.99% per annum of the second tranche will be converted into equity shares, leading to some dilution. Both tranches are issued at par via private placement and are secured by hypothecation of current/movable assets and mortgage of fixed assets.
This is a balance-sheet restructuring move rather than fresh fundraising, indicating the company is working with lenders to reschedule obligations. The unusually low 0.01% coupon on NCD-II and the partial equity conversion suggest lenders accepted significant concessions, pointing to underlying financial stress. Shareholders should watch for equity dilution from the NCD-II conversion and any further impact on existing debt covenants.
